If a person falls behind financially, technology may be among the first cuts people are forced to make. Recent reports of several school districts in California that are having approximately 10% of their students missing or unaccounted for during a typical school day during October during the Pandemic. It is a disturbing trend. Social workers and school officials are scouring the area to locate children missing from classes only to find find some homes shattered and in disarray with many families struggling to provide basic needs let alone internet services. Food and shelter make email and wireless internet services mute in comparison. Many families do not have a choice.
